Niches versus neutrality: uncovering the drivers of diversity in a species‐rich community

Remi Vergnon; Nicholas K. Dulvy; Robert P. Freckleton
Ecology Letters · Vol. 12, Issue 10 · pp. 1079-1090 · 2009

Abstract

Ecological models suggest that high diversity can be generated by purely niche‐based, purely neutral or by a mixture of niche‐based and neutral ecological processes. Here, we compare the degree to which four contrasting hypotheses for coexistence, ranging from niche‐based to neutral, explain species richness along a body mass niche axis. We derive predictions from these hypotheses and confront them with species body‐mass patterns in a highly sampled marine phytoplankton community. We find that these patterns are consistent only with a mechanism that combines niche and neutral processes, such as the emergent neutrality mechanism. In this work, we provide the first empirical evidence that a niche‐neutral model can explain niche space occupancy pattern in a natural species‐rich community. We suggest this class of model may be a useful hypothesis for the generation and maintenance of species diversity in other size‐structured communities.
